The accountant of Weatherspoon Shoe Co. has compiled the following information from the company's records as a basis for an inco

me statement for the year ended December 31, 2010.
Rental revenue $29,000
Interest expense 18,000
Market appreciation on land above cost 31,000
Wages and salaries-sales 114,800
Materials and supplies-sales 17,600
Income tax 30,600
Wages and salaries-administrative 135,900
Other administrative expenses 51,700
Cost of goods sold 516,000
Net sales 980,000
Depreciation on plant assets (70% selling, 30% administrative) 65,000
Dividends declared 16,000


There were 20,000 shares of common stock outstanding during the year.

(a) Prepare a multiple-step income statement. (Round earnings per share to 2 decimal places, e.g. 5.25. For multiple entries list from largest to smallest amounts, e.g. 10, 5, 1. Enter all amounts as positive amounts and subtract where necessary.)

Answer:

                                 WEATHERSPOON SHOE C0.

                              Income Statement

                                                           $                         $  

Net Sales                                                               980,000

Cost of Goods sold                                                <u>516,000</u>

Gross Profit                                                             464,000

Operating Expenses:

selling expenses

materials and supplies - Sales               17,600

Wages and Salaries - Sales                 114,800

Dep on plant asset - Selling                     19500    151,900

Administrative expenses

wages and salaries  - Administrative  135,900

other administrative expenses               51,700

Dep on Plant asset - Administrative        45,500   <u> 233,100</u>

Operating Profit                                                          79,000

Non-operating/ Other

Rental revenue                                          29,000

Interest expenses                                      18,000

Market appreciation on land above cost  31,000

Income tax                                                   <u>30,600</u>      <u>11,400</u>

Net Income                                                                    <u> 90,400</u>

Earnings per share =  Earnings / number of common shares outstanding

                               =  $90,400/ 20,000 =  $4.52

Dividend discount model (DDM) is used to calculate intrinsic value of a stock. Since the dividends are expected to grow indefinitely, the formula will be as follows;

Price (P0) = D1 / (r-g)

where D1 = Next year's dividend = 2.50

r = required rate of return = 12% or 0.12 as a decimal

g = dividend growth rate = 7%

Price (P0) = 2.50/(0.12-0.07)

P0 = 2.50 /0.05

P0 = $50
